The concept of the national character of vessel refers to the unique attributes and cultural values that are embodied in the design, construction, and operation of a ship or boat from a particular nation. Throughout history, vessels have not only served functional purposes but have also been a reflection of the society that built them. For instance, the traditional fishing boats of the Mediterranean exhibit distinct features that resonate with the maritime culture of the region, including their vibrant colors and intricate designs. These characteristics are not merely aesthetic; they tell stories of the people who rely on the sea for their livelihood, thus encapsulating the national character of vessel in a tangible form.In contrast, modern vessels such as container ships and luxury yachts may seem to lack this cultural depth at first glance. However, they still represent the national character of vessel in different ways. For example, the engineering prowess and technological advancements showcased in these ships often reflect a nation's commitment to innovation and economic power. Countries like Japan, known for their high-quality manufacturing, produce vessels that are not only efficient but also symbolize their reputation for precision and excellence.Moreover, the national character of vessel can also be seen in the way different cultures approach maritime practices. In Scandinavian countries, for instance, there is a strong emphasis on sustainability and environmental consciousness in shipbuilding. This reflects a broader societal value placed on protecting natural resources, which is an integral part of their national identity. On the other hand, nations with a rich history of exploration, such as Portugal and Spain, often celebrate their maritime heritage through festivals and historical reenactments, thereby reinforcing the national character of vessel as a source of pride and cultural continuity.Furthermore, the national character of vessel extends beyond physical attributes to include the traditions, rituals, and stories associated with seafaring. Many cultures have deep-rooted maritime legends that highlight the relationship between their people and the sea. For example, the Polynesians have a rich history of navigation that is steeped in mythology, showcasing how their vessels were not just means of transport but also carriers of cultural significance. This intertwining of narrative and nautical design illustrates the profound impact of the national character of vessel on a nation’s identity.In conclusion, the national character of vessel is a multifaceted concept that encompasses the aesthetic, functional, and cultural dimensions of maritime craftsmanship. It serves as a mirror reflecting the values, history, and aspirations of a nation. As we continue to explore the seas and develop new technologies, it is essential to remember the significance of our vessels as embodiments of our national character. By appreciating this relationship, we can foster a deeper understanding of not only our maritime heritage but also the diverse cultures that shape our world today.
